Output 8557c60f7589305b066e87d2e9f895197e7902fc9d390d0394ee29fa93529f1b:2

value
2556804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d94bf0f9443a7b0e83de85567dea0aea4828411 OP_EQUAL
address
3Qoq59qSNvngsoJKL3mYN6YK2EJuPLrc8H
transaction
8557c60f7589305b066e87d2e9f895197e7902fc9d390d0394ee29fa93529f1b
spent
true